Transaction 33dbc371e28166ce3f34f95d11deccbc0e4f419fe9a62e2e5ace15086fa24e34
1 Input
1 Output
-
33dbc371e28166ce3f34f95d11deccbc0e4f419fe9a62e2e5ace15086fa24e34:0
- value
- 76355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3cc545ad5c5c30ccf914a6eed55fee49cc071860 OP_EQUAL
- address
- 37ELnmJhZhykzUWSb6HjE6whiH8x5TLSu7